Abstract
The utility model discloses a flowerpot with breathable inner basin, which belongs to the improvement of flowerpot structures, and mainly comprises an external basin, an inner basin and a water storage disc, Wherein the inner basin is disposed in the external basin through the cooperative arrangement between the inner basin flanging and the external basin step; the water storage disc is disposed under the external basin; the bottom of the external basin contacts with the ground through a pulley; a water outlet pipe is disposed at the top of the water storage disc and a pumping plant is connected to the outer end of the water outlet pipe. The utility model is advantageous in that firstly water can be stored in the water storage disc, thereby the water in the basin bottom can be absorbed by flower roots to benefit the growth of flowers, and the following situation that when water exceeds through spillway holes, the ground under the flowerpot will be polluted can be prevented; secondly problems like flowers in the basin can not breathe, the change of a basin is not convenient, watering is not even, the soil is easy to get hard, watering has no metering can be resolved; thirdly water can be reused for several times, thereby flowers are easy to manage and more comfortable in the basin.
